    An older male client who fell down several stairs 4-hours ago is scheduled for magnetic resonance imaging (MRI). What information should the practical nurse (PN) obtain from the client?

    Explanation & Rationale

    Correct Answer: B. Rationale: A. The last time food was consumed may be relevant for some medical procedures but isn't directly related to an MRI. B. Knowing the presence of a metal implant is crucial before an MRI due to potential interference with the machine. C. History of the previous myelogram might be relevant but is not as critical for an MRI. Allergy to iodine-based dyes is more pertinent for procedures like a CT scan with contrast, not necessarily an MRI.
